Ingredients

  • 400g Condensed Milk
  • 250g All purpose flour
  • 25g Unsweetened Cocoa
  • Pinch Salt
  • 125g Butter
  • 1 Egg
  • 3 tablespoons Milk
  • 30g Butter
  • 30g Sugar
  • 1 tsp Cinnamon

Instructions

1
For the filling place the can in a large pot and wrap completely with liquid.
2
bubble for two and a half hours, occassionally adding liquid.
3
Let cool before opening.
4
For further tips, please check here.
5
2 For the pastry mix combine the baking flour, cocoa dusting fragrant element, and seasoning in a large mixing bowl.
6
introduce the cold shortening in small pieces and rub into crumbs with your fingers introduce the egg and work into a pastry mix.
7
You may have to introduce dairy liquid, a tablespoon at a time if it still is to parched.
8
Wrap and cool down for at least half an hour or overnight.
9
3 Line a baking sheeet with parchment paper and preheat the oven to 180 degrees Celsius.
10
4 Roll out the pastry mix on a lightly floured surface, it should be thin.
11
Cut out circles of 12cm either with a cookie cutter or with a smaller plate/dish.
12
Put two to three teaspoons of the dulce de leche in the middle of each circle.
13
Brush the edges with dairy liquid, I do this with my pinkie.
14
Fold each circle in half so that you have a half moon and press down the edges with a fork.
15
You can also turn the edges about half a centimeter inwards every centimeter or so to create a pattern.
16
5 Place the prepared empanadas on the baking sheet and brush with egg wash.
17
toast for about 20-25min.
18
6 Towards the end of the baking time, soften the remaining shortening and combine the sweetener and cinnamon in a small mixing bowl.
19
Once you take the empanadas out, immediately brush with the shortening and shower with the sweetener combine.
20
Empanadas can be enjoyed either still mildly hot or cold.
21
If eating mildly hot, be careful not to char yourself with burning filling!.
